Under 500 New COVID-19 Cases in Ontario

A dip in the number of new COVID-19 infections in Ontario.

Officials are confirming 486 new COVID-19 cases in the province, along with 18 more deaths. 

Due to a data clean up, 16 of the deaths reported today occurred over two months ago. 

There are 372 new cases in individuals are aren't fully vaccinated or whose status isn't known, as well as 114 in double-dosed people. 

There were 17,369 tests completed. 

Currently, there are 295 people hospitalized with the virus in Ontario, and 156 people are in the ICU due to COVID-19. 

Over 20.5 million vaccinations have been administered throughout the province, with 82.3 percent of Ontarians 12 and older having one dose, and 75.1 percent fully immunized.
